Multiplex is currently undertaking early planning for the Canberra Lyric Theatre Project, which will deliver a landmark 2,000-seat new lyric theatre. This major redevelopment will transform the existing Canberra Theatre Centre precinct to better support international, national, and local performances, concerts, and events. Construction will be staged and carried out in a live environment, ensuring other venues at the Centre remain operational throughout. As an HSE Coordinator on this landmark project, you'll play a key role in driving health, safety, and environmental excellence across our projects. You'll partner with project teams to ensure compliance, foster strong relationships with stakeholders, keep records and systems up to date, and champion opportunities for continuous improvement. Candidates will interpret legislation and certification requirements and implement them into practice while supporting and guiding subcontractors in the delivery of their scope of works effectively. You'll maintain and monitor WHSE system compliance, investigate incidents promptly and thoroughly, and share lessons learned across the project. Success will come from your ability to identify, communicate, and resolve issues quickly and effectively. We're seeking a Safety professional with proven industry experience, strong systems knowledge and the ability to translate systems and processes into practical solutions. You'll need a solid understanding of relevant legislation, Codes of Practice, Australian Standards and other related documentation, along with a track record of positively influencing and improved HSE outcomes.
